(a) In this section, “governing board” means a board of directors, managers, trustees, or visitors.
(b) The Governor may appoint 1 or more individuals who are discreet to represent the Governor at a meeting of the governing board of a corporation or institution that receives financial assistance from the State Treasury.
(c)(1) An individual appointed under this section may attend any meeting of the governing board.
(2) At the meeting, the individual may not vote, but may give an opinion on any matter being considered or discussed.
